King of it's segment !!

I have a lot to talk about the bike but in this review, let's take a look at some of it's pros and cons and I think these matter a lot for those who are gonna buy a new bike.


So, if you are the one who want's to know about the bike before buying it, this blog is for you. So, lets get started.


First of all let's talk about the overall build quality of the bike, it's just awesome and one word I can say about the bike is there is no compromise in quality section, but sometimes bike can cause a disturbance for you because bike creates a lot of vibrations and this may be irritating for some riders.


So, let's talk about the mileage and this is the main part of concern in India, this bike can deliver you upto 40kms/litre when driven properly and this ratio is according to both city+ highway conditions.


The main concern in this bike is bike is on the heavier section and this may be irritating for some rider's and this can be a serious concern for those rider's who basically likes to ride the bike in the city conditions and have a lot's of traffic in cities and had to stop the bike again and again. It can really cause pain.


Let's talk about the comfort this bike offers and in this section bike is really well balanced. Bike is really comfortable, no doubt and no matter of concern where you drive the bike whether on rash roads or on those plane mirror like highways.


The bike comes with wider tyres and tyres really offers a better road grip and if you ride the bike on those rainy roads, no matter of concern for you but for your safety drive the bike safely.


Braking section is also very good in this bike. Brakes are really very confidence inspiring and one thing I can say about the braking section that you will never loose control on the bike, even in some emergency braking conditions.


The bike really looks appealing from the first day when you buy the bike, till the last journey on the bike and it's a design which is being around for years.


The bike has it's own different presence on the roads and the best thing I like about the bike is that, this machinery can lasts for years if properly taken care of, and one thing to really take care of when purchasing this bike is that bike does not come with the fuel indicator and this can be very frustating for some riders.
